4.0 out of 5 stars Glad I Bought It!, July 31, 1998
By A Customer
This review is from: Voight: Precision Training for Body & Mind (Paperback)
I'll admit it, I bought this book because I liked its style. But the content is what has truly impressed me. I've found every exercise to be effective, especially because each exercise is fully illustrated and clearly explained. Voight's advice and delicious recipes have also helped me maintain my exercise program and lose weight. This book has given me the focus I needed to get in shape. One word of warning; if you have a bad back, like I do, be very careful when doing the lower back exercises in the book. Those exercises assume that the person doing them has a strong, flexible back and if you don't you can really hurt yourself.

5.0 out of 5 stars The Fitness Guru Writes!, December 29, 2000
This review is from: Voight: Precision Training for Body & Mind (Paperback)
If you are looking for an introduction to fitness, need some inspiration, or are just trying to figure out how to get into the exercise mind-set...this book can show you the way. You will want to read this book on a regular basis to keep yourself motivated and your dreams of becoming fit alive!

Karen has a philosophy of exercise, which comes across in all her videos and especially in this book. She believes in controlled movements for maximum results. You will not waste one minute if you follow her instructions. She is known for inspiring millions of women with her best-selling workout videos.

Karen believes that people don't follow through with their fitness program because it doesn't fit into their lifestyle.

"Understanding that exercise needs to be a priority in your life is essential to staying on a program." --Karen Voight

As a Karen Voight fan, I have collected her videos and have found them to be the best on the market. Her book is also the best fitness book for women I have found so far. Each picture in this book is Karen! She actually posed for each shot. In this way, she can literally show you how to do each exercise.

This book has many pages of pure text, and Karen is an excellent writer. She gives four steps to get your fitness program on track and then dives into a chapter on how to find real satisfaction from exercise. In the next chapter, she focuses on weight loss and lifestyle. After discussing the five guidelines you must follow to achieve low body fat and defined muscles, Karen gives attention to each muscle group by providing a series of sequential photographs to explain the exercises. (pg. 32-87).

These pages contain exercises for the arms, legs, buttocks, abdominals and back. You will recognize these exercises from the videos, but this book is nice to take with you when you are traveling. The last chapter of this book contains 20 most-asked questions. You can discover everything from beginning to exercise to how often you should exercise. This book is designed to inspire women of all fitness levels. One look at Karen's sleek physique and you will be running to your workout room! Karen has truly found total fitness. The kind which heals the body, mind and spirit. Her Yoga videos are also quite relaxing, yet challenging.

During you workout sessions, you might start to see roadblocks and this might keep you from working out. Karen explains the possible causes for these roadblocks and gives the solutions so you keep motivated and Karen can keep her credentials as a Top Instructor. She really excels at motivation and you can also trust her to give you the best information on fitness. She is unquestionably the leader in the fitness world. The fitness-savvy stars of Hollywood are quite fortunate to have her to instruct them. Now you can also have her as your very own in-home instructor. Just put in a video or take out this book and Karen's motivational message will walk into your life.

5.0 out of 5 stars Great back exercises...worth the price of the book alone, May 30, 2004
By A Customer
This review is from: Voight: Precision Training for Body & Mind (Paperback)
I'm new to Karen Voight's exercise programs..only having tried some of her routines this year. I was so impressed with the video, that I decided to get the book. Another reviewer commented on the back exercises....I must admit that finding them in the book was a nice surprise, as most fitness instructions tend to focus on the usual bottom, abs, legs, and sometimes arms. After using the back exercises just a few times, I've noticed a nice line of separation around the spine. I tend to slouch sometimes, and my shoulders are now much squarer. I didn't think the book carried much on the way of the "mind", that's included in the title, but does address a proper fitness attitude. Also included are diet tips, and how to work fitness into a busy schedule. Great photos, and very simple explanations for the workouts. Karen says in the book that she used to dance and model swimsuits, and that her exercises are geared to those 2 body types. Her figure alone is a testament to her system. This book is worth the investment!

4.0 out of 5 stars Beautifully illustrated guide to women's fitness, August 19, 2005
This review is from: Voight: Precision Training for Body & Mind (Paperback)
Renowned fitness instructor Karen Voight released this book in 1996 as an exercise and weight loss guide for women. Her goal was to help women to commit themselves to a healthy lifestyle and to make exercise a priority in their lives. She identifies five factors that are particularly important for helping women to achieve low body fat and defined muscles as follows: 1) moderate intensity, 2) high frequency, 3) long duration, 4) lower body emphasis, and 5) compound followed by an individual exercise. Keeping these factors in mind, she present chapters on five main body areas--arms, legs, buttocks, abdominals, and back--offering a series of weighted exercises as well as precise instruction for each of these areas. She also includes an excellent chapter on stretching, an often-neglected but necessary part of a fitness regimine.

Follow the exercise information, Karen offers helpful motivational tips and then moves into healthy eating. Here, I found her information to be a bit dated. Although her "seven sensible menus" would still be fairly viable today, some of her recommendations--e.g., to snack on carbs-ladden rice cakes--are not as current. But for the most part, however, Karen Voight has managed to create a timeless fitness manual which is enhanced by the beautiful, sepia-toned photographs of Karen's amazingly fit body executing the exercises. This would be a helpful book for any woman looking to embark on a basic exercise program as taught by a master instructor.
